Design Hub Inc Salary

As of August 2026, the average hourly salary for employees at Design Hub Inc in the United States is $47. This translates to an approximate annual wage of $96,831. Salaries at Design Hub Inc typically range from $41 to $52 hourly,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Ann Arbor?

Understanding the cost of living near Ann Arbor is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Design Hub Inc.
Ann Arbor's Cost of Living Index is approximately 117.5 (17.5% more expensive than US average; 28.7% more than MI average). Home to Univ. of Michigan, desirable, high housing costs, tech presence. TheRide b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Design Hub Inc,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,500 - $2,300+ A significant portion of Design Hub Inc sal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$58 (TheRide monthly pass, free for UMich)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$430 - $640 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$450 - $800+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$400 - $750+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,978 - $4,728+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
